Output bab776f72d42259394896480d31ad141c287b86dc3d81b5cb170630afdaedee3:50

value
99381
script pubkey
OP_0 OP_PUSHBYTES_20 3df86b21da7b14d31f5fc67c7129a6324ba17f80
address
bc1q8huxkgw60v2dx86lce78z2dxxf96zluqsy2y9s
transaction
bab776f72d42259394896480d31ad141c287b86dc3d81b5cb170630afdaedee3
spent
true